Output c2642ffe23dff80098e975b6085841cd2c6ca34c1b63795a8e3b30646378313b:1

value
878579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67f05f001643e0255daa3e3d5e95b0a1cf23dc72 OP_EQUAL
address
3BAbUaXDrbpxH51sRsDApdGqu1rSuVfb8r
transaction
c2642ffe23dff80098e975b6085841cd2c6ca34c1b63795a8e3b30646378313b
confirmations
45366
spent
true